Recent job nearby: a motorhome in Halesowen with a perfect starter battery and a leisure bank at 9V. Split charge relay had failed — habitation side was never charging on the move.
Recent job nearby: a converted campervan off M5 J3 where a self-installed DC-DC charger was wired to a switched live and only worked with the ignition on.

The leisure bank, or the split charge system that feeds it. The starter battery is clearly fine if the engine turns over.
Not sensibly. Starter batteries hate deep discharge and will fail quickly in a habitation role; leisure batteries are built for exactly that cycling.
